Stabilize tempest job

Bug #1707496 reported by Dima Kuznetsov
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
DragonFlow
Fix Released
High
Dima Kuznetsov

Bug Description

A lot of basic functionality tests fail in tempest, this bug is for tracking changes aimed at stabilizing it.

Dima Kuznetsov (dimakuz)
description: updated
Dima Kuznetsov (dimakuz)
Changed in dragonflow:
importance: Undecided → High
assignee: nobody → Dima Kuznetsov (dimakuz)
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to dragonflow (master)

Reviewed: https://review.openstack.org/489002
Committed: https://git.openstack.org/cgit/openstack/dragonflow/commit/?id=fecfb298b911d7a994c9d810521ef08a2eb86dd0
Submitter: Jenkins
Branch: master

commit fecfb298b911d7a994c9d810521ef08a2eb86dd0
Author: Dima Kuznetsov <email address hidden>
Date: Sun Jul 30 14:18:22 2017 +0300

    Move tempest tests filter to a common place

    It is best to maintain one copy of this list.

    Change-Id: Ibdce9a04e7f1db04d89ca8104cbee8051bf73e00
    Partial-Bug: #1707496

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Related fix proposed to dragonflow (master)

Related fix proposed to branch: master
Review: https://review.openstack.org/495856

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to dragonflow (master)

Reviewed: https://review.openstack.org/483385
Committed: https://git.openstack.org/cgit/openstack/dragonflow/commit/?id=9427d8ec95aa63ffdd670ecdf751b97cd8ac07aa
Submitter: Jenkins
Branch: master

commit 9427d8ec95aa63ffdd670ecdf751b97cd8ac07aa
Author: Dima Kuznetsov <email address hidden>
Date: Thu Jul 13 16:10:07 2017 +0300

    Disable l3 agent in gate

    L3 agent creates namespace for each router and plugs it into br-ex and
    br-int. This creates a conflict because an interface in the new namespace
    responds to traffic bound for br-int (DNAT), preventing DNAT from
    working.

    This patch disables l3 agent and adds code that configures br-ex in gate

    Partial-Bug: #1707496
    Change-Id: If5f58689d961421a374f8992c16a919fbc91b7eb

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Related fix merged to dragonflow (master)

Reviewed: https://review.openstack.org/495856
Committed: https://git.openstack.org/cgit/openstack/dragonflow/commit/?id=843a85267160062482c8f40e9bdc73a58bfdb8e4
Submitter: Jenkins
Branch: master

commit 843a85267160062482c8f40e9bdc73a58bfdb8e4
Author: Dima Kuznetsov <email address hidden>
Date: Mon Aug 21 16:41:26 2017 +0300

    L3 router plugin: support agent scheduler conditionally

    Our L3 router plugin will complain if agent scheduler extension is
    advertised by the plugin, yes not agents available.

    This patch splits the plugin into 2 types, so devstack / deployer can
    use the one that fits the deployment.

    Change-Id: Ieb21189df61967f7dff62ec9ad631b2a5f3dacad
    Related-Bug: #1707496

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to dragonflow (master)

Reviewed: https://review.openstack.org/489003
Committed: https://git.openstack.org/cgit/openstack/dragonflow/commit/?id=4fbec4f4c0741edb6207d762cc92e48c6f249eec
Submitter: Jenkins
Branch: master

commit 4fbec4f4c0741edb6207d762cc92e48c6f249eec
Author: Dima Kuznetsov <email address hidden>
Date: Sun Jul 30 14:21:52 2017 +0300

    Disable L3 agents scheduler extension in Tempest

    Change-Id: Ibc2d85bce9abb821e897693ebdade66d3b9199c3
    Closes-Bug: #1707496

Changed in dragonflow:
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.